ABBYY: The Process-First Intelligence Engine
ABBYY is not a “cloud-first AI company” — it’s a process intelligence company that evolved into AI. That distinction matters. ABBYY excels where documents are deeply tied to regulated workflows like finance, tax, customs, and insurance underwriting. Its FlexiCapture and Vantage platforms are widely deployed in European banks and government systems because of their explainability and auditability.
(Source: ABBYY Official Product Docs; European Banking Automation Case Studies)
Google Document AI: Scale, Speed, and ML Firepower
Google Document AI is unmatched in raw ML model performance and language coverage. It shines when document volumes are massive, document types are diverse, and latency matters. However, Google assumes you already have strong engineering and compliance layers — it’s a power tool, not a guided system.
(Source: Google Cloud AI Documentation; Google Cloud Enterprise Architecture Guides)
Microsoft Azure AI Document Intelligence: Enterprise Integration King
Microsoft’s strength is not just OCR — it’s ecosystem dominance. Azure AI Document Intelligence integrates seamlessly with Power Platform, Dynamics 365, SharePoint, Purview, and Sentinel, making it the default choice for Microsoft-heavy enterprises. It’s not always the most accurate — but it’s the fastest to operationalize.
(Source: Microsoft Azure AI Docs; Microsoft Purview Compliance Docs)
Security & Compliance (This Is Where Deals Are Won)
All three platforms meet baseline enterprise security, but depth differs.
ABBYY: Strongest in EU compliance, on-premise deployments, and regulated audit trails (GDPR, ISO 27001).
(Source: ABBYY Security Whitepapers)Google: Excellent infrastructure security, but shared responsibility model puts compliance burden on customers.
(Source: Google Cloud Shared Responsibility Model)Microsoft: Deepest compliance tooling via Purview, eDiscovery, and Sentinel.
(Source: Microsoft Trust Center)
REAL 2026 PRICING (Verified)
Pricing below is official list pricing as of January 2026. Enterprise discounts vary.
Pricing Comparison Table
| Platform | Pricing Model | Cost (USD) |
|---|---|---|
| ABBYY Vantage | Per page / volume | ~$0.045–$0.12 per page |
| Google Document AI | Per page + processor | ~$0.03–$0.10 per page |
| Microsoft Azure AI | Per page | ~$0.02–$0.08 per page |
Reality check: ABBYY looks expensive until you factor reduced exception handling and audit costs. Google looks cheap until you add engineering overhead. Microsoft is cost-efficient if you’re already in Azure.
(Source: ABBYY Pricing Page; Google Cloud Pricing; Microsoft Azure Pricing)

When Each Platform Is the WRONG Choice
Don’t choose ABBYY if you want plug-and-play ML without process mapping.
Don’t choose Google if you lack strong internal AI governance.
Don’t choose Microsoft if your stack isn’t already Azure-first.
